Customization at Its Best
One of my favorite things about Yahoo Mail is how customizable it is. You can change the theme, switch up the layout, and even tweak the way your inbox looks. It’s like having a mini design studio in your pocket. And let’s be honest, who doesn’t love a bit of personalization in their apps?
All About Efficiency
Now, let's talk about productivity. Yahoo Mail isn’t just a pretty face; it’s got brains too. The app comes with features like smart views and quick actions that help you manage your emails efficiently. You can swipe to delete, mark as read, or flag emails. Plus, with its robust search functionality, finding that elusive message from weeks ago is a cinch.
Security and Privacy
In an age where data breaches are as common as coffee shop selfies, Yahoo Mail takes your privacy seriously. It offers strong encryption and spam filters that keep the junk out of your inbox. It’s like having a digital bouncer who’s always on duty, ensuring only the right emails get through.
All-In-One App
Beyond emails, Yahoo Mail integrates with calendars and contacts, making it a one-stop-shop for all your organizational needs. You can even manage other email accounts through it, so it's not just limited to Yahoo addresses. It’s like having a personal assistant that doesn’t need coffee breaks.
